Cup and saucer

Cup, earthenware, waisted spreading foot-rim, rounded bottom, the upper body of the cup slightly inset from the lower body, cylindrical sides flaring out to an everted lip-rim, high loop handle with stepped shoulder curving downwards from a sharp top point; transfer-printed in blue with to the exterior sides of the cup a small scene showing an elaborately gabled building oriental buiding with large spreading flower besides it, and a small scene showing a Chinese figure bearing a parasol and a basket standing on a fenced terrace with a large flower growing out of an urn to one side, a flower head to the interior bottom of the cup, deep ornate border to the interior lip-rim of stylized flower heads and foliage on a deep blue ground, a running border of flowers and leaves to the handle. Saucer, earthenware, circular shape, standing on a narrow rounded foot-rim with curving spreading sides; transfer-printed in blue with to the centre of the well a scene showing a Chinese figure bearing a parasol and basket standing on a fenced terrace with a large flower growing out of an urn to one side and a duck with spread wings in the foreground, border to the rim as on the cup.
